Thiess Indonesia Preferred Tenderer for Trans Java Toll Road Packages 1 & 2
July 16, 2008

PT Thiess Contractors Indonesia has been nominated preferred tenderer for two major sections of the Trans Java Toll Road Package by the Indonesian Government's toll road authority, BPJT on 19 May 2008.

Thiess Indonesia has been awarded 35 year concessions for the 69.20 km Solo - Mantingan - Ngawi Toll Road and 49.51 km Ngawi - Kertosono Toll Road, both sections of the Trans Java Toll Road. The Public Private Partnership model will include investments worth US$829 million.
Thiess Indonesia is also the preferred bidder on the Jakarta Outer Ring Road 2 Package 3 from Cinere to Serpong with their consortium partner Waskita Karya. The combination of the three toll road packages takes Thiess' total investment into Indonesian infrastructure projects up to US.1.2 billion over the next few years.
Thiess Indonesia will undertake the construction of the four lane motorway with several river crossings and five interchanges. Land acquisition and associated funding remain the responsibility of the Government and are yet to be completed. The construction works are expected to commence in 2009 after the Government completes land acquisition.

Thiess Indonesia's President Director, Roy Olsen said, "This section of Trans Java is a good fit with Thiess's growing investment in Indonesian. We have been operating in Indonesia for twenty years on a number civil construction and mining projects, however, have not been the lead investor."

"Thiess has extensive involvement in similar toll road investment projects in Australia and we are confident our skills and experience will deliver quality infrastructure in Indonesia."

Mr Olsen congratulated the Indonesian Government on its initiative to involve private sector in the development of critical infrastructure works and for allowing foreign investors to help support the Government in delivering the vital infrastructure. He was confident the partnership would deliver quality infrastructure and greater benefits to the areas surrounding the project.
